Job Description:
Description Maintenance Carpenter: The maintenance carpenter
uses the maintenance process to perform carpenter work required in
the maintenance and construction of SMRMC Health buildings and
equipment. Must understand basis of building design and
construction of all major components. Must be able to set up the
appropriate equipment and materials need by work order prints, or
sketches for a job. Must have skills to build or modify anything
needed for organization, including complete departments or complete
building. Must be able to estimate materials and tools for job.
Must know carpenter safety. Maintenance Plumber: The maintenance
plumber has the responsibility to maintain, install, and dismantle
all plumbing systems, fittings, and hydraulics required for new
construction or maintenance. Needs an understanding for design of
equipment, plumbing system, and city water delivery systems
preventative maintenance and repair. Must have an understanding of
plumbing problems and trouble shoot as necessary. Must have
knowledge of plumbing safety. Willing to be crossed trained to
perform other maintenance duties when necessary. Maintenance
Electrician: The maintenance electrician needs to know how to
safely analyze and correct electrical problems, repair and overhaul
electrical equipment and controls throughout the organization. This
position requires a through, knowledge of electrical theory,
principles, statuary codes, properties of material, principles of
operations of electrical equipment. Needs to understand and be able
to analyzes circuits, wiring diagrams and drawings to install,
repair, calibrate service to replace electronic devices and
systems. Has an understanding of OHM’S Law. Must be willing to be
crossed trained and used in other areas of maintenance if needed.
Maintenance Air Conditioner /Refrigeration: The maintenance air
conditioner/refrigeration is responsible for installing,
dismantling, performing preventive maintenance repair on all
AC/Refrigeration units throughout the organization. Must have a
universal HVAC license or must be able to obtain one. Will be
responsible for servicing ac/refrigeration equipment by checking,
testing, and replacing faulty parts and devices. Ability to access
ac/refrigeration failure and to use gages to check pressure lines
prior to disengaging line. Understands design equipment, preventive
maintenance and repair of air conditioning and refrigeration units.
Understands the law regulating refrigerant and the principals
involving the recovery of refrigerant. A general knowledge of
safety equipment and how to operate all equipment safely. Plans
details of work by determining supply needs and logical safe
approach to solve problems. Must complete all work assignments in
the time allowed. Must be willing to be crossed trained and used in
other maintenance areas if needed. Must keep work area clean at all
time. Preventive Maintenance Mechanic II: The preventive
maintenance mechanic safely performs and schedules preventative
maintenance of a variety of equipment. It is their responsibility
to check, clean, test, and service equipment as directed. Must
carry out all scheduled as well as day to day preventative
maintenance on air filters, oil pumps, bearings, etc. and set time
frames for all maintenance duties. The preventative maintenance
mechanic is responsible for all duties in the hospital and outlying
facilities. Must be willing to assist in any area of maintenance if
needed. Complete all work assignments on time and keep work area
clean. Maintenance Painter: The painter performs all painting and
surface preparation for the hospital and outlying facilities. The
painter is responsible for determining the correct equipment and
material needed for the jog. Has an understanding of the basic
chemical components of paint, thinners, glue, and removers. Knows
the safe handling procedures for all paint products and how to
remove paint correct and safe. Has knowledge on how to mix paint to
achieve the desired color. Responsible for erecting scaffolds,
ladders and safety barriers in line with local mechanical “safe
work procedure”. Must be willing to be crossed trained to help in
any area of maintenance if needed. Complete all work assignments on
time, and keep work area clean at all times. Maintenance Welder:
The maintenance welder performs all kinds of welding, brazing, and
cutting using gas and electric welding equipment. Repairs all metal
items as needed to support the maintenance program, and work with
other maintenance personal to solve problems. Needs a special
knowledge of stainless-steel work. Responsible for fabricating
equipment by cutting burning, and welding various metals. Repairs
equipment by using welding techniques and the appropriate welding
equipment. A general knowledge of safety procedures is required.
Plans details of work by determining supply needs and the most
logical and safe approach job. Must complete all work order on
time, and keeps work area clean at all times. Grounds Keeper :
Under general supervision of the Director of Maintenance, uses the
landscaping process to safely maintain grounds, trees, shrubs,
etc., in a manner that compliments the hospital. The groundskeeper
is responsible for the grooming of all trees, shrubs, landscaping,
grass, trash, etc., through-out the hospital grounds. At all times
work assignments will be determined by adjustment of work- loads,
staff levels, and needs of the organization. As determined by the
Director of Maintenance, the groundskeeper will be assigned up to
40 hours a week; overtime and call back may be required. Day shift
only; Monday – Friday, 7:00 a.m.- 3:30 p.m. The groundskeeper is
expected to function within the scope of approved policies,
procedures, and regulations for the department and organization.
Will be responsible to assist with orientation, preceptorship, and
management of personnel assigned to unit. Must be able to work and
relate in a professional, non-defensive manner with peers,
physicians, administration, patients, and visitors. Attendance to
yearly mandatory education requirements is nonnegotiable and will
be the responsibility of the employee to arrange and attend
sessions. All maintenance personnel must follow all policies and
procedures set by SMRMC Health for the facility and for the
Maintenance Department. Must work in a professional manner at all
times and keep a record of all work assignments in an orderly
manner.
